Disney Reveals Opening Seasons For Star Wars Theme Park Lands
Disney's "Star Wars"-themed lands at its California and Florida resorts now have opening seasons. Star Wars: Galaxy's Edge will open first at Disneyland in Anaheim in the summer of 2019, followed by a late autumn opening for the one at Disney's Hollywood Studios at the Walt Disney World Resort in Orlando.
The 14-acre themed areas will represent a location on a planet called Batuu, which the company previously called "a remote outpost on the galaxy's edge that was once a busy crossroads along the old sub-lightspeed trade routes."
Guests will be able to interact with characters, work to support either the Resistance or the First Order and develop a "reputation" within the Star Wars environment.
